Address

PV5XTuZoyrHAHb47wMX6gFpRj5W1fhBpd9

0 MONA

Confirmed
Total Received9.46252792 MONA
Total Sent9.46252792 MONA
Final Balance0 MONA
No. Transactions2

Transactions

PV5XTuZoyrHAHb47wMX6gFpRj5W1fhBpd99.46252792 MONA
 
 
PV5XTuZoyrHAHb47wMX6gFpRj5W1fhBpd99.46252792 MONA